Russian rescuers found the body of the fourth victim of the explosion in Beirut under the rubble, the operational headquarters said.

“Rescuers of the Ministry of Emergency Situations found the body of the fourth who died at the site of parsing debris at an elevator in the port of Beirut,” quotes a TASS report on Thursday, August 8.

Earlier, the rescuer of the Ministry of Emergency Situations Andrei Nizhnikov spoke about the analysis of debris after an emergency in the Lebanese capital.

According to him, the main task of the rescuers is to find places where living people can stay. These cavities are carefully examined and rechecked. Nizhnikov also noted that Russian rescuers are actively cooperating with their French and Lebanese colleagues.

On August 5, EMERCOM employees arrived in Beirut to deal with the consequences of a powerful explosion. The next day, mobile hospitals were deployed in the Lebanese capital. In the first two days of work, Russian doctors received more than 90 people, including 12 children.

An explosion took place in the port of Beirut on 4 August. Killed, according to the latest data, 154 people and more than 5 thousand were injured. According to Prime Minister Hassan Diab, the explosion was caused by improper storage of ammonium nitrate weighing 2,750 tons in a warehouse in the port.
